03/07/02 Clearly The Best Named Winner Today....
Senor Skase, who won a 1550 metre Maiden at Canterbury in Sydney today, must rank as one of Australia's best named gallopers.

Trained by Gai Waterhouse, Senor Skase with Jim Cassidy aboard proved too strong for Martino and Spire in the Giddy Up Handicap.

Senor Skase is by the leading international stallion Last Tycoon and out of the mare So and So.

The three-year-old bay gelding was bred by well known breeder and businessman Gerry Harvey in New South Wales.

Senor Skase won by a length and a quarter.
